Understanding Fascia and Gutter Replacement: A Comprehensive Guide
When it pertains to home maintenance, many house owners typically neglect the significance of fascia and rain gutters, despite their important role in protecting the structural integrity of a home.

This post delves into the intricacies of fascia and gutter systems, discussing their functions, the indications showing a requirement for replacement, and the steps included in the replacement process.
What is Fascia?
Fascia refers to the horizontal board that runs along the edge of a roofing, serving as a barrier between the roofing system and the external environment. Usually made of wood, vinyl, or aluminum, fascia plays a considerable role in:
Supporting the lower edge of the roofing systemOffering an ended up appearance to the eavesProtecting the underlying rafters and insulation from weather condition componentsServing as an installing point for rain gutters
The condition of the fascia is vital, as harmed or decaying fascia can result in water infiltration, mold growth, and extensive structural damage.
Understanding Gutters
Rain gutters are the channels created to gather and reroute rainwater from the roofing far from your house's structure. Like fascia, rain gutters are vital for maintaining a home's integrity. Properly working gutters prevent:
Water damage to the foundationSoil disintegration around the homeBasement floodingMold and mildew development
Normally made from products such as aluminum, copper, or vinyl, seamless gutters must be regularly preserved to guarantee they carry out effectively.
Indications of Fascia and Gutter Damage
Homeowners ought to be vigilant for signs that suggest the need for fascia and gutter replacement. Typical indications include:
Fascia Damage SignsDecaying or Crumbling: This usually results from extended water exposure.Drooping: A bowing fascia might mean that it no longer provides appropriate support.Noticeable Mold: Presence of mold shows extreme moisture.Cracks or Holes: Structural integrity is compromised with substantial cracks.Gutter Damage SignsRust or Corrosion: Particularly in metal rain gutters, rust shows advanced wear and tear.Separation: If rain gutters are pulling away from the fascia, they need immediate attention.Puddles Around the Foundation: This can indicate that seamless gutters are not directing water appropriately.Overflowing Water During Rain: This symbolizes blockages or misalignment.The Importance of Fascia and Gutter Replacement
Ignoring fascia and gutter maintenance can cause different costly concerns, including:
Foundation Damage: Water pooling can erode the foundation.Roofing Damage: Water can back up into the roof products, causing leaks.Interior Water Damage: This can lead to damaged drywall, insulation, and motivate mold development.
Changing fascia and seamless gutters can help reduce these concerns while making sure a home's aesthetic appeal.
Actions for Fascia and Gutter Replacement1. Assessment
The primary step is a thorough evaluation of the existing fascia and gutter systems. This frequently includes looking for signs of wear, measurement, and material determination.
2. Elimination
The old fascia and gutter systems need to be carefully gotten rid of. This may include:
Detaching rain gutters from the fascia.Removing any screws or nails holding the fascia in place.Making sure to prevent damage to the roofing or surrounding locations.3. Installation of New Fascia
As soon as the old products are eliminated, the next step includes:
Installing brand-new fascia boards, guaranteeing they are level and properly aligned.Sealing any joints or seams to prevent water infiltration.4. Gutter Installation
Following the fascia replacement, brand-new rain gutters can be installed by:
Securing the gutters to the brand-new fascia using brackets.Guaranteeing the gutter system has an appropriate slope for efficient water circulation.Including downspouts to direct water far from the foundation.5. Ending up Touches
After the installation, applying a protective surface to the fascia might be beneficial, specifically for wooden boards.

How typically should fascia and seamless gutters be changed?
Usually, fascia and gutters can last in between 20-50 years, depending on the materials utilized. Regular maintenance can extend this life. Examinations need to be carried out yearly, especially after extreme weather.
2. How can I preserve my fascia and seamless gutters?
Regular assessments and cleansings are essential. Property owners ought to eliminate debris from seamless gutters, check for blockages, and examine for any signs of damage. Guaranteeing proper drain away from the home can likewise help.
3. What products are best for fascia and gutters?Fascia: Common products include wood, vinyl, and aluminum, with aluminum often being chosen for its resilience.Rain gutters: Options consist of aluminum, copper, PVC, and steel. Aluminum is popular due to its light-weight nature and resistance to rust.4. Can I set up seamless gutters without changing fascia?
While it is possible to replace seamless gutters without changing fascia, it is recommended to assess the condition of the fascia. If the fascia is harmed, it's best to change both concurrently to guarantee a waterproof system.
